메뉴 건너뛰기




Volumn , Issue , 2011, Pages 457-490

Best Practices in Architecting Cloud Applications in the AWS Cloud

Author keywords

Applications best practices in architecting cloud applications in the AWS cloud; Decoupling components using queues; Elasticity, one of the fundamental properties of cloud elasticity, power to scale computing resources up and down easily and with minimal friction

Indexed keywords


EID: 84886185520     PISSN: None     EISSN: None     Source Type: Book    
DOI: 10.1002/9780470940105.ch18     Document Type: Chapter
Times cited : (46)

References (62)
  • 1
    • 70350667044 scopus 로고    scopus 로고
    • Cloud Architectures
    • 2007-07-01
    • J. Varia, Cloud Architectures, http://jineshvaria.s3.amazonaws.com/public/cloudarchitectures-varia.pdf, 2007-07-01.
    • Varia, J.1
  • 2
    • 84886207451 scopus 로고    scopus 로고
    • Amazon EC2 Detail Page
    • Amazon EC2 Detail Page, http://aws.amazon.com/ec2.
  • 3
    • 84886112325 scopus 로고    scopus 로고
    • Amazon CloudWatch Detail Page
    • Amazon CloudWatch Detail Page, http://aws.amazon.com/cloudwatch/
  • 4
    • 84886159506 scopus 로고    scopus 로고
    • Auto-scaling feature
    • Auto-scaling feature, http://aws.amazon.com/auto-scaling
  • 5
    • 84886222011 scopus 로고    scopus 로고
    • Elastic Load Balancing feature
    • Elastic Load Balancing feature, http://aws.amazon.com/elasticloadbalancing
  • 6
    • 84886129157 scopus 로고    scopus 로고
    • Elastic Block Store
    • Elastic Block Store, http://aws.amazon.com/ebs
  • 7
    • 84886180485 scopus 로고    scopus 로고
    • Amazon S3
    • Amazon S3, http://aws.amazon.com/s3
  • 8
    • 84886162998 scopus 로고    scopus 로고
    • Amazon CloudFront
    • Amazon CloudFront, http://aws.amazon.com/cloudfront
  • 9
    • 84886143013 scopus 로고    scopus 로고
    • Amazon SimpleDB
    • Amazon SimpleDB, http://aws.amazon.com/simpledb
  • 10
    • 84886130808 scopus 로고    scopus 로고
    • Amazon RDS
    • Amazon RDS, http://aws.amazon.com/rds
  • 11
    • 84886203811 scopus 로고    scopus 로고
    • Amazon SQS
    • Amazon SQS, http://aws.amazon.com/sqs
  • 12
    • 84886196965 scopus 로고    scopus 로고
    • Amazon ElasticMapReduce, and Amazon Simple Notification Services (Amazon SNS)
    • Amazon ElasticMapReduce, http://aws.amazon.com/elasticmapreduce and Amazon Simple Notification Services (Amazon SNS)
  • 13
    • 84886134238 scopus 로고    scopus 로고
    • Amazon Virtual Private Cloud
    • Amazon Virtual Private Cloud, http://aws.amazon.com/vpc
  • 14
    • 84886134455 scopus 로고    scopus 로고
    • Amazon Flexible Payments Service, Amazon DevPay
    • Amazon Flexible Payments Service, http://aws.amazon.com/fps and Amazon DevPay, http://aws.amazon.com/devpay
  • 15
    • 70349528388 scopus 로고    scopus 로고
    • Scalable Internet Architectures
    • Sams Publishing, 2006-07-31
    • T. Schlossnagle, Scalable Internet Architectures, Sams Publishing, 2006-07-31.
    • Schlossnagle, T.1
  • 16
    • 84886104080 scopus 로고    scopus 로고
    • Wikipedia Article
    • Wikipedia Article, http://en.wikipedia.org/wiki/Slashdot_effect
  • 17
    • 84886205384 scopus 로고    scopus 로고
    • Memcached Web site
    • Memcached Web site, http://www.danga.com/memcached/
  • 18
    • 84886198093 scopus 로고    scopus 로고
    • Shard Lessons
    • 2008-08-24
    • D. Pritchett, Shard Lessons, http://www.addsimplicity.com/adding_simplicity_ an_engi/2008/08/shard-lessons.html, 2008-08-24.
    • Pritchett, D.1
  • 19
    • 82155169818 scopus 로고    scopus 로고
    • On designing and deploying Internet-scale services
    • in 21st Large Installation System Administration conference (LISA 'O7)
    • J. Hamilton, On designing and deploying Internet-scale services, 2007, in 21st Large Installation System Administration conference (LISA 'O7), http://mvdirona.com/jrh/talksAndPapers/JamesRH_Lisa.pdf
    • (2007)
    • Hamilton, J.1
  • 20
    • 84902303179 scopus 로고    scopus 로고
    • Building Scalable Databases: Pros and Cons of Various Database Sharding Schemes
    • 2009-01-16
    • D. Obasanjo, Building Scalable Databases: Pros and Cons of Various Database Sharding Schemes, http://www.25hoursaday.com/weblog/2009/01/16/BuildingScalableDatabasesProsAndConsOfVariousDatabaseShardingSchemes.aspx, 2009-01-16.
    • Obasanjo, D.1
  • 21
    • 84886212774 scopus 로고    scopus 로고
    • The Federation: Database Interoperability
    • 2003-04-23
    • M. Lurie, The Federation: Database Interoperability, http://www.ibm.com/developerworks/data/library/techarticle/0304lurie/0304lurie.html, 2003-04-23.
    • Lurie, M.1
  • 22
    • 84886231792 scopus 로고    scopus 로고
    • Building Scalable, Reliable Amazon EC2 Applications with Amazon SQS
    • Amazon SQS Team
    • Amazon SQS Team, Building Scalable, Reliable Amazon EC2 Applications with Amazon SQS, http://sqs-public-images.s3.amazonaws.com/Building_Scalabale_EC2_applications_with_SQS2.pdf, 2008.
    • (2008)
  • 23
    • 84886212299 scopus 로고    scopus 로고
    • Chef
    • Chef, http://wiki.opscode.com/display/chef/Home
  • 24
    • 84886158779 scopus 로고    scopus 로고
    • Puppet
    • Puppet, http://reductivelabs.com/trac/puppet/
  • 25
    • 84886187732 scopus 로고    scopus 로고
    • CFEngine
    • CFEngine, http://www.cfengine.org/
  • 26
    • 84886222051 scopus 로고    scopus 로고
    • Genome
    • Genome, http://genome.et.redhat.com/
  • 27
    • 84886155240 scopus 로고    scopus 로고
    • Wikipedia Article
    • Wikipedia Article, http://en.wikipedia.org/wiki/Just_enough_operating_system
  • 28
    • 84886167091 scopus 로고    scopus 로고
    • Instance metadata and userdata
    • Instance metadata and userdata, http://docs.amazonwebservices.com/AWSEC2/latest/DeveloperGuide/index.html?AESDG-chapter-instancedata.html
  • 29
    • 84886189308 scopus 로고    scopus 로고
    • Boot From Amazon EBS feature
    • Boot From Amazon EBS feature, http://developer.amazonwebservices.com/connect/entry.jspa?externalID53121
  • 30
    • 84886164486 scopus 로고    scopus 로고
    • How to Share a Snapshot section
    • How to Share a Snapshot section, http://aws.amazon.com/ebs/
  • 31
    • 84886218821 scopus 로고    scopus 로고
    • Hadoop website
    • Hadoop website, http://hadoop.apache.org/
  • 32
    • 84886121099 scopus 로고    scopus 로고
    • Amazon S3 Team, Amazon S3 Error Best Practices, 2006-03-01
    • Amazon S3 Team, Amazon S3 Error Best Practices, http://docs.amazonwebservices .com/AmazonS3/latest/index.html?ErrorBestPractices.html, 2006-03-01.
  • 33
    • 84886211155 scopus 로고    scopus 로고
    • Query 201: Tips and Tricks for Amazon SimpleDB Query
    • Amazon Simple DB Team, 2008-02-07
    • Amazon Simple DB Team, Query 201: Tips and Tricks for Amazon SimpleDB Query, http://developer.amazonwebservices.com/connect/entry.jspa?externalID51232&categoryID5176, 2008-02-07.
  • 34
    • 84886177236 scopus 로고    scopus 로고
    • Building for Performance and Reliability with Amazon SimpleDB
    • Amazon SimpleDB Team, 2008-04-11
    • Amazon SimpleDB Team, Building for Performance and Reliability with Amazon SimpleDB, http://developer.amazonwebservices.com/connect/entry.jspa?externalID51394&categoryID5176, 2008-04-11.
  • 35
    • 84886195248 scopus 로고    scopus 로고
    • Query 101: Building Amazon SimpleDB Queries
    • Amazon SimpleDB Team, 2008-02-07
    • Amazon SimpleDB Team, Query 101: Building Amazon SimpleDB Queries, http://developer.amazonwebservices.com/connect/entry.jspa?externalID51231& categoryID5176, 2008-02-07.
  • 36
    • 84886191016 scopus 로고    scopus 로고
    • Amazon Import Export Services
    • Amazon Import Export Services, http://aws.amazon.com/importexport
  • 37
    • 84886206712 scopus 로고    scopus 로고
    • Wikipedia Article
    • Wikipedia Article, http://en.wikipedia.org/wiki/Sneakernet
  • 38
    • 82255163814 scopus 로고    scopus 로고
    • Overview of Security Processes
    • Amazon Security Team, 2009-06-01
    • Amazon Security Team, Overview of Security Processes, http://awsmedia.s3.amazonaws.com/pdf/AWS_Security_Whitepaper.pdf, 2009-06-01.
  • 39
    • 84886111755 scopus 로고    scopus 로고
    • Verisign SSL
    • Verisign SSL, http://www.verisign.com/ssl/
  • 40
    • 84886225504 scopus 로고    scopus 로고
    • EnTrust SSL
    • EnTrust SSL, http://www.entrust.net/ssl-products.htm
  • 41
    • 84886117102 scopus 로고    scopus 로고
    • Escaping Restrictive/Untrusted Networks with OpenVPN on EC2
    • E. Hammond, Escaping Restrictive/Untrusted Networks with OpenVPN on EC2, http://alestic.com/2009/05/openvpn-ec2, 2009-05-02.
    • Hammond, E.1
  • 42
    • 84886182695 scopus 로고    scopus 로고
    • GNUPG
    • GNUPG, http://www.gnupg.org
  • 43
    • 84886137945 scopus 로고    scopus 로고
    • PGP
    • PGP, http://www.pgp.com/
  • 44
    • 84886144612 scopus 로고    scopus 로고
    • Creating HIPPA-Compliant Medical Data Applications with AWS
    • Amazon Web Services Team, 2009-04-01
    • Amazon Web Services Team, Creating HIPPA-Compliant Medical Data Applications with AWS, http://awsmedia.s3.amazonaws.com/AWS_HIPAA_Whitepaper_Final.pdf, 2009-04-01.
  • 45
    • 84886227443 scopus 로고    scopus 로고
    • The Encrypting File System
    • R. Bragg, The Encrypting File System, http://technet.microsoft.com/en-us/library/cc700811.aspx, 2009.
    • (2009)
    • Bragg, R.1
  • 46
    • 84886191094 scopus 로고    scopus 로고
    • Best Practices For Encrypting File System (Windows)
    • Microsoft Support Team
    • Microsoft Support Team, Best Practices For Encrypting File System (Windows), http://support.microsoft.com/kb/223316, 2009.
    • (2009)
  • 47
    • 84886228287 scopus 로고    scopus 로고
    • TrueCrypt
    • TrueCrypt, http://www.truecrypt.org/
  • 48
    • 84886220165 scopus 로고    scopus 로고
    • EnCFS
    • EnCFS, http://www.arg0.net/encfs
  • 49
    • 84886190082 scopus 로고    scopus 로고
    • AES
    • AES, http://loop-aes.sourceforge.net/loop-AES.README
  • 50
    • 84886147504 scopus 로고    scopus 로고
    • DM-Crypt
    • DM-Crypt, http://www.saout.de/misc/dm-crypt/
  • 51
    • 84886136626 scopus 로고    scopus 로고
    • TrueCrypt
    • TrueCrypt, http://www.truecrypt.org/
  • 52
    • 84886196336 scopus 로고    scopus 로고
    • ZFS filesystem
    • ZFS filesystem, http://www.opensolaris.org/os/community/zfs/
  • 53
    • 84886130690 scopus 로고    scopus 로고
    • Solaris Security Team, ZFS Encryption Project (OpenSolaris), 2009-05-01
    • Solaris Security Team, ZFS Encryption Project (OpenSolaris), http://www.opensolaris. org/os/project/zfs-crypto/, 2009-05-01.
  • 54
    • 80755127667 scopus 로고    scopus 로고
    • How to keep your AWS credentials on an EC2 instance securely
    • 2009-08-31
    • S. Swidler, How to keep your AWS credentials on an EC2 instance securely, http://clouddevelopertips.blogspot.com/2009/08/how-to-keep-your-aws-credentials-onec2.html, 2009-08-31.
    • Swidler, S.1
  • 55
    • 84886147307 scopus 로고    scopus 로고
    • AWS announcement
    • AWS announcement, http://aws.amazon.com/about-aws/whats-new/2009/08/31/seamlessly-rotate-your-access-credentials/
  • 56
    • 84886178027 scopus 로고    scopus 로고
    • Multi-factor Authentication
    • Multi-factor Authentication, http://aws.amazon.com/mfa/
  • 57
    • 84886157234 scopus 로고    scopus 로고
    • AWS Management Console
    • AWS Management Console, http://aws.amazon.com/console/
  • 58
    • 84886180847 scopus 로고    scopus 로고
    • Amazon EC2 User Guide, Security Group description
    • Amazon EC2 User Guide, Security Group description, http://docs.amazonwebservices. com/AWSEC2/2009-07-15/UserGuide/index.html?using-network-security.html
  • 59
    • 84886161763 scopus 로고    scopus 로고
    • Microsoft Windows Firewall, March
    • Microsoft Windows Firewall, http://technet.microsoft.com/en-us/library/cc779199(WS.10).aspx, March 2003
    • (2003)
  • 60
    • 84886165027 scopus 로고    scopus 로고
    • Netfilter Website
    • Netfilter Website, http://www.netfilter.org/
  • 61
    • 84886174486 scopus 로고    scopus 로고
    • Hadoop Map/Reduce Tutorial, The Apache Software foundation
    • Hadoop Map/Reduce Tutorial, The Apache Software foundation, http://hadoop.apache.org/common/docs/ro.19.2./mapred_tutorial.html, 2008
    • (2008)
  • 62
    • 84886229824 scopus 로고    scopus 로고
    • Amazon S3 Team, Best Practices for using Amazon S3, 2008-11-26
    • Amazon S3 Team, Best Practices for using Amazon S3, http://developer.amazonwebservices.com/connect/entry.jspa?externalID51904, 2008-11-26.


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.